Krohne and Samson Introduce “FOCUS-ON”

Krohne and Samson unveiled their joint venture "FOCUS-ON". "FOCUS-ON" is a new company established for the development, manufacturing and marketing of specialized actuators in compliance with process industry 4.0. With the announcement of the partnership, the new company is presenting a major innovation that combines valve and measurement technologies with unique diagnostic and control functions in a single unit. Officials from both companies stated that this important innovation is "the world's first intelligent process node, a combination of process instrumentation and control equipment specially developed for the process industry". Krohne and Samson, which hold equal stakes in "FOCUS-ON" established in Dordrecht, the Netherlands, stated that the foundations of the "FOCUS-ON" investment were laid as a result of their collaboration spanning more than 25 years on projects worldwide.
The presentation of this strategic partnership in instrumentation and the newly established joint venture was conducted by Samson CEO Dr. Andreas Widl and Krohne CEO Stephan Neuburger.
In the presentation, Widl, stating that "leading innovations in the digital age can only be achieved through collaboration", noted that "here we see a collaboration taking place with full confidence in plain sight". Neuburger later said, "As our first product, we combined our innovative approaches to decentralized control and predictive maintenance, bringing our ideas together and thus 'FOCUS-ON' emerged." The technological motivation behind the module's development was explained by Samson CTO Dr. Thomas Steckenreiter as follows: "With FOCUS-ON, we are taking a decisive step towards autonomous factories capable of autonomous production by optimizing themselves autonomously." Krohne CTO Dr. Atilla Bilgiç expressed his thoughts by saying, "Developing the adaptive control function was only the first step. More important is the integration of artificial intelligence with diagnostic functions. Our autonomous actuator knows its current status, can anticipate future conditions and, with its learning capability, can adapt to applications." The intelligent process node combines three functions: sensor, actuator and control. The module measures flow in a pipeline and independently regulates the valve function to reach specified setpoints. Neuburger continued his summary of the subject as follows: "We are confident that this product will significantly reduce the complexity of a facility. Another advantage of the product is that it has the ability to optimize a process through comprehensive diagnostics in a way that enables better and more efficient control of resources. In this way, facility efficiency can be significantly increased." he said. Thanks to integrated measurement sensors for flow, temperature and pressure, problems such as cavitation can be identified or anticipated. Wear of valves and pipes can be prevented or significantly reduced. This will enable facilities to operate continuously without interruption for longer periods. Sales of the intelligent process node are expected to begin in the first quarter of 2020.
